如何预防出现乱码_第1页
如何预防出现乱码_第2页
如何预防出现乱码_第3页
如何预防出现乱码_第4页
如何预防出现乱码_第5页
已阅读5页,还剩18页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

如何预防出现乱码xx年xx月xx日目录CATALOGUE了解乱码产生的原因选择正确的字符编码避免在编写代码时出现乱码测试和验证代码的正确性修复已出现的乱码问题01了解乱码产生的原因当源文件的编码格式与目标环境的解码方式不一致时,会导致乱码的出现。总结词在处理文本文件时,不同的软件和平台可能使用不同的字符编码标准,如UTF-8、GBK等。如果源文件的编码格式与目标环境的解码方式不匹配,就会出现乱码。因此,在处理文本文件时,应确保源文件的编码格式与目标环境一致。详细描述编码不匹配总结词字符集是用于表示字符的编码集合,如果源文件的字符集与目标环境的字符集不兼容,会导致乱码的出现。详细描述不同的字符集支持不同的字符集范围和编码方式。如果源文件的字符集与目标环境的字符集不兼容,就会出现乱码。因此,在处理文本文件时,应确保源文件的字符集与目标环境兼容。字符集问题文件损坏或软件问题总结词文件损坏或软件问题也可能导致乱码的出现。详细描述文件损坏或软件问题可能导致文本文件中的数据被错误地解析或显示,从而出现乱码。因此,在处理文本文件时,应确保文件完整无损,并使用可靠的软件工具进行操作。02选择正确的字符编码统一码Unicode是一种字符编码标准,它为每种语言中的每个字符提供了一个唯一的数字码,确保了文本的准确性和一致性。支持多种语言Unicode支持全球几乎所有语言的字符,包括拉丁语、希腊语、中文、日文等。跨平台兼容性由于Unicode的普遍应用,它在不同操作系统、软件和设备之间具有很好的兼容性。Unicode可变长度编码UTF-8采用可变长度字节来表示字符,使得它能够高效地利用存储空间。兼容ASCIIUTF-8与ASCII编码兼容,这意味着在UTF-8编码中,英文字符的码与ASCII码相同。广泛应用UTF-8是目前互联网上最常用的字符编码,它支持全球各种语言的字符。UTF-030201简体中文字符集GB2312和GBK是中国国家强制标准,用于表示简体中文字符。支持中文常用字它们包含了中文常用字的编码,使得在简体中文环境中进行文本处理更加方便。局限性GB2312和GBK仅支持简体中文字符,对于繁体中文字符或其他语言字符则无法支持。GB2312/GBK03避免在编写代码时出现乱码使用正确的文本编辑器使用支持UTF-8编码的文本编辑器,如VisualStudioCode、SublimeText等。确保编辑器设置中启用了UTF-8编码,并避免使用其他非标准的编码方式。在保存文件时,选择UTF-8编码方式,以确保文件内容正确显示。避免使用非标准的编码方式,以免在读取文件时出现乱码。保存文件时选择正确的编码VS在编写代码时,避免使用特殊字符,特别是非标准ASCII字符。如果必须使用特殊字符,请确保了解其正确的编码方式,并在代码中正确处理。在编写代码时注意特殊字符04测试和验证代码的正确性使用在线编码检测工具在线编码检测工具可以帮助开发者快速检测代码中是否存在乱码问题,提高代码的正确性和可读性。总结词在线编码检测工具可以对代码进行语法检查、格式化、自动补全等功能,同时还能检测代码中的编码问题,如乱码、特殊字符等。使用这些工具可以有效地提高代码的质量和可读性,减少因编码问题导致的乱码问题。详细描述集成开发环境(IDE)内置的编码检测功能可以帮助开发者在编写代码时及时发现和纠正乱码问题。许多IDE都提供了内置的编码检测功能,可以在编写代码时实时检测和提示编码问题,如乱码、特殊字符等。这些功能可以帮助开发者在编写代码时及时发现和纠正问题,提高代码的正确性和可读性。总结词详细描述使用IDE内置的编码检测功能总结词手动检查代码中的特殊字符是一种简单但有效的预防乱码的方法。详细描述在编写代码时,开发者需要特别注意特殊字符的使用,如引号、括号、注释符等。这些特殊字符如果不正确使用,可能会导致乱码问题。因此,开发者需要手动检查代码中的这些特殊字符,确保它们的正确使用,以避免出现乱码问题。手动检查代码中的特殊字符05修复已出现的乱码问题记事本:在Windows系统中,可以使用记事本作为文本编辑器,打开乱码文件后,选择“文件”->“另存为”,在编码中选择正确的编码格式(如UTF-8),然后保存文件。NotepadNotepad是一款功能强大的文本编辑器,支持多种编码格式。使用Notepad打开乱码文件后,在菜单栏中选择“编码”->“转为UTF-8编码”即可。使用文本编辑器转换编码乱码转换器网上有很多乱码转换器可供使用,这些工具可以将乱码文件转换为正确的编码格式。只需上传乱码文件,选择正确的编码格式,即可下载转换后的文件。要点一要点二小工具除了在线转换工具外,还有一些小工具可以帮助修复乱码问题。这些小工具通常支持多种编码格式,可以快速将乱码文件转换为正确的格式。使用在线工具修复乱码重置软件设置有些软件可能会因为设置错误而导致乱码问题。尝试重置

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论